What is Bytewax?
Bytewaxは、リアルタイムデータストリームを処理するためのスケーラブルなデータフロー構築を目的とした、オープンソースのPythonフレームワークです。Apache Flinkなどの従来のツールと比較して、開発者は強力なストリーミングパイプラインを5倍速く、総保有コスト(TCO)を80%削減して作成できます。エッジデバイスからクラウド環境まで、あらゆる場所へのデプロイメントをサポートするBytewaxは、Javaベースのシステムの複雑さなしに、ストリーム処理の力を活用しようとする組織にとってシームレスなソリューションを提供します。
主な機能:
? Pythonネイティブパイプライン:Pythonを使用してステートフルなデータストリーミングパイプラインを構築し、SQLを超えた高度な変換を可能にし、Pythonの広範なライブラリエコシステムを活用します。
? 容易なデプロイメント:
waxctlCLIを使用して、単一のコマンドでデータフローをデプロイし、CI/CDフレームワーク内でアジャイルな開発を実現します。? スケーラブルで柔軟性が高い:Kubernetes、仮想マシン、Jupyter Notebookなどの純粋なPython環境をサポートし、エッジからクラウドまでデータフローをスケールします。
?️ モジュール式拡張:BytewaxのModule Hubを介して、事前構築済みのコネクタ、オペレータ、エンドツーエンドのデータフローを使用して機能を拡張します。
? 堅牢な管理:Bytewax Platformを通じて、高度な可観測性、災害復旧、自動スケーリング機能を使用して、データフローを安全にスケーリングおよび管理します。
ユースケース:
GenAI向けリアルタイムフィーチャパイプライン:GenAI企業は、Bytewaxを使用して、埋め込みを生成し、ベクトルデータベースにストリーミングするリアルタイムフィーチャパイプラインを構築し、AIモデル開発を加速しています。
エアギャップ環境におけるIoTデータ処理:IoTソリューションプロバイダーは、エアギャップ環境にBytewaxをデプロイして、エッジでデータを処理および分析し、インターネット接続なしで信頼性の高いリアルタイムインサイトを確保しています。
リアルタイムMLワークロード:大手航空宇宙企業は、Bytewaxを統合してリアルタイム機械学習ワークロードを処理し、Apache Flinkよりもアクセスしやすく、設定が高速であるため、本番稼働までの時間を最大8倍削減しています。
結論:
Bytewaxは、リアルタイムデータ処理パイプラインを合理化しようとする開発者やデータエンジニアにとって画期的な存在です。Pythonの容易さとRustのパフォーマンスを組み合わせることで、Bytewaxは、より高速な開発、より低いインフラストラクチャコスト、エッジからクラウドまでのシームレスなスケーラビリティを実現します。GenAI、IoT、リアルタイムMLのいずれに取り組んでいても、Bytewaxは効率的で信頼性の高いストリーム処理のための最適なソリューションです。





